21 new Covid-19 infections in Singapore, all imported
Thursday, 08 Apr 2021 6:03 PM MYT
SINGAPORE, April 8 — Singapore reported 21 new cases of Covid-19, all of which were imported.
All 21 cases had been placed on stay-home notices upon arrival in Singapore, said the Ministry of Health (MOH) in a press release.
There are no new locally transmitted cases, the ministry added.
The total number of Covid-19 cases in Singapore now stands at 60,575.
"We are still working through the details of the cases, and further updates will be shared via the MOH press release that will be issued tonight," MOH said. — TODAY
